Offers a residential program for adults with a diagnosis of serious mental illness. It is located within a 13 bed group home with staffing 24-hours a day, seven days a week and it provides residents with all their meals. The staff provide supportive counseling, personal care and grooming, and assistance with daily living tasks to residents and assistance with medications. The program empowers residents to make choices by focusing on their strengths.

Residential setting offering 24/7 supervision and supports to help young adults learn to manage the symptons of their mental health condition(s) through individual and group therapy while simultaneously learning the necessary skill required to live sucessfully and independently. Individuals are assisted to gain employment and independent housing prior to leaving the program after 18 to 24 months.

Provides specialized housing for persons with severe mental illness. Residential care provides assistance with tasks of daily living that includes: Psychiatric Rehabilitation, Transportation, Shopping, Maintaining Appointments, Recreational Activities, Money Management, Socialization, and Supervision of self-administered medications.
